episode Back That Pass Up - Ep. 19: America's Fastime cover

Back That Pass Up - Ep. 19: America's Fastime

TV ratings for baseball have been going downhill faster than Jennifer Lopez's career. She still got dat ass, though. Anyway, watching baseball on TV is becoming more of a pain than a method of relaxation and enjoyment. It just moves so slowly! Pitchers taking their time between pitches, batters stepping out of the box to shake the sweat out of their batting gloves after every pitch, fielders picking their noses or adjusting their junk. Bud Selig has vowed that the average time for a baseball game will drop from its current run time of over three hours to a more tolerable 2 hours and 20 minutes. Do you think the potential rule changes could make the difference? Do you actually want to see these rule changes or does it ruin the sanctity of the game?
